본문 바로가기

스프레틱스5

[새싹 x 코딩온] 웹 개발자 과정_ 1차 프로젝트 회고(1) HTML, CSS, JS에 이어 Node.js, ejs, MySQL 까지 배우고 드디어 첫 프로젝트를 마치게 되었습니다. 1.목표와 계획 평가: 프로젝트를 시작할 때 설정한 목표와 계획을 다시 살펴보고, 이를 얼마나 달성했는지를 평가합니다. 목표 달성도를 어떻게 평가하였는지 설명하고, 만약 목표를 달성하지 못한 경우 그 이유를 분석합니다. 우선은 기본적인 crud의 자유 주제에 맞추어 저희는 여러 주제를 던지고 최종적으로 개발자를 위한 컨퍼런스 행사 모음과 리뷰 사이트로 선정되었습니다. (저희 사이트 이름도 Conferences & Reviews for U! Developers의 C.R.U.D입니다) 9월 4일에 팀원 결정,5일에 주제를 선정, 본격적인 기획 및 개발은 9월 6일 부터 발표일인 9월 22.. 2023. 10. 1.
[새싹x코딩온] 웹 개발자 부트캠프 과정 4주차 회고 | 클라이언트 & 서버 오늘은 CS 지식에 대해 꽤 익혀서, 그에 대해 정리해보려고 합니다. 이번 글은 클라이언트와 서버에 대해 정리해보겠습니다. 매번 검색해보다 '클라이언트'와 '서버'라는 용어가 많이 나왔는데 모호하게 알고 있다 알게 되어 좋았습니다. 클라이언트(client)의 영어 본래 의미는 고객인데, 일반 고객보다 어떤 전문적인 서비스를 받는 고객을 의미합니다. 예를 들어 변호사같은 사람에게 자문을 받는 고객의 경우를 들 수 있습니다. 네트워크의 세계에서는 한 사람의 user를 의미합니다. 사용자인 사람이 될 수도 있고, 사용자의 컴퓨터 혹은 모바일 기기일 수도 있습니다. 하나의 공통된 특징이라 하면 바로 어떤 요청(request)의 주체라는 점입니다. 여기서의 이 요청은 서버를 거쳐야 하는 예를 들어 아이디와 패스워.. 2023. 8. 7.
[새싹x코딩온] 웹 개발자 부트캠프 과정 3주차 회고 | Grid System 오늘은 수업 시간에 다룬 부트스트랩(Bootstrap)의 grid system에 대해 소개해 보려 합니다. 먼저 부트스트랩에 대해서 소개하자면, html, css, js 등을 이용해 간단하게 웹페이지를 구성할 수 있는 여러 요소들을 미리 디자인해놓은 사이트입니다. 위의 왼쪽 이미지와 같이 코드를 붙여 넣어 여러 종류의 버튼을 구현할 수도 있고, card list를 생성할 수도 있습니다. 물론 html 내의 head 태그 내에 Bootstrap의 이 소스를 활용할 수 있도록 연결해주는 CDN 코드를 붙여 넣어야 합니다. 해당 CDN link는 아래에서 확인할 수 있습니다. https://getbootstrap.com/docs/5.3/getting-started/introduction/ Get started.. 2023. 8. 7.
[새싹x코딩온] 웹 개발자 부트캠프 과정 2주차 회고 | 자료형에 따른 pass 1) Primitive 자료형: Pass by Value 우선, Primitive 자료형에는 Boolean(true, false), Number(숫자 및 NaN), String(문자), Null(빈 값), Undefined(타입도 값도 없는 상태)가 있다. 이런 원시 타입(Primitive Type)에는 값(value)이 복사되어 전달된다. 코드로 보면 다음과 같다. let num = 1; let num2 = num; console.log(num, num2); //1 1 console.log(num === num2); //true num = 5; console.log(num, num2); //5 1 console.log(num === n.. 2023. 7. 29.